Eric:

I'm working on the new incarnation of lore.kernel.org (that will run on
multiple frontends as opposed to the centralized version we have now) -- I
hope to have everything ready to go by the time 1.7.x rolls out. I wonder if
you can give some pointers for extindex and /all, specifically:

- what needs to go into the config file to enable the feature? I poked at the
  source, and it appears that this will do it?:
  [extindex "all"]
  topdir = /path/to/where/xap15/will/live

- when "public-inbox-index" runs in grok-post script, will it automatically
  update the "all" extindex without any additional flags, or do we need to
  pass something special to it?

- when handling message-id based lookups, will the "all" extindex be used
  automatically, if found?

> - what needs to go into the config file to enable the feature? I poked at the
>   source, and it appears that this will do it?:
>   [extindex "all"]
>   topdir = /path/to/where/xap15/will/live

Yes, I would run `public-inbox-extindex' to create the extindex
before altering the config file.

It's probably safe to use --no-fsync by default and some larger
value of --batch-size= since you have beefy machines.  The
initial index of lore took over 30 hours for me IIRC; but
that's on an ancient machine with a SATA2 SSD.

I'm not 100% sure how configuration should work since there's no
"public-inbox-extindex-init" command (and I'm not sure if it's
necessary).

> - when "public-inbox-index" runs in grok-post script, will it automatically
>   update the "all" extindex without any additional flags, or do we need to
>   pass something special to it?

Yes.  However I've been favoring using --no-update-extindex with
plain -index, and then doing "public-inbox-extindex --all /path/to/extindex"
after all -index are done to reduce transactions.

> - when handling message-id based lookups, will the "all" extindex be used
>   automatically, if found?

Yes, it should be.
